Double Glazed Window Repairs

Over time double glazing can develop problems such as mist between glass or decaying frame. These issues are simple to fix and could be less expensive than you thought.

You may have a warranty on your double glazing, make sure to check with the company you purchased it from. It is also recommended to resolve any issues yourself.

Sealing

Window seals (also called uPVC seals) play a vital role in the insulation and double-glazed windows. Insufficient seals can cause drafts, condensation and other issues. Seals that are damaged can be repaired or replaced to improve the efficiency of your double-glazing.

Water leaking between glass panes is the most common sign of double-glazed windows that require to be resealed. This moisture could damage your window frames and increase energy bills. Moisture in between glass frames can create a hazy appearance that fluctuates in accordance with temperature and humidity levels.

Glass

Double-glazed windows comprise two glass panes with an air space in between. The air is usually filled with a gas such as Krypton or argon, which hinders the passage of heat through your windows. This allows you to maintain your home's temperature at a comfortable level without putting too much strain on your cooling and heating systems. You'll need to fix your double-glazed window as quickly when it starts to crack or broken.

Usually replacing the glass in your double-glazed window is the most effective solution to repair it. However it is important to realize that repairing a double-paned glass involves more than just replacing the glass. It also means replacing the factory seal that allows your window to work as it should. It is always better to hire professionals to fix your double glazing than to try to do it yourself.

Misting is a typical issue with double-glazed windows. This happens when the seal around a glass panel fails allowing moisture-laden air get in between the glass panes. This can cause the window to become cloudy or wet, and can also affect the insulating ability of double-glazed windows.

This type of problem is difficult because it could cause significant damage to the appearance and efficiency of your double-glazed windows. Hardware

Double-glazed windows can face various issues over time. Some of these problems include leaks, water intrusion, and foggy windows. Many people believe that they need to replace their entire window when these issues occur but the reality is that the majority of them can be fixed without the need for an entirely new installation.

The first step to repair double-glazed windows is to take off the old pane. To prevent further damage to your glass you must be careful when removing the existing pane. The next step is to remove any sealants or paints from the edges of the glass. This can be accomplished using either a putty knife, or a scraper. After the old pane is removed, the new one can be put inside the frame. A new layer of sealant needs to be applied.

If the window is still covered by warranty, you might be able to request that the manufacturer to replace the glass unit free of charge. If not, employ a professional to examine and repair the window.

The hardware is just as important as the glass in windows with double glazing. The sash as well as the balance are used to open and close the window. These parts can cause problems with the window and could even pose safety hazards. If the sash or balance are damaged, it's best to speak with an expert in double glazing for repair services.

Condensation in between the panes is a common issue with double-glazed windows. This occurs when warm air comes in contact with cooler window panes. While this is a natural process however, it can result in water infiltration and the rotting process. Installing a ventilator in your home is the best method to prevent this.

In many instances, it is possible to fit slim profile double glazed units in listed structures without compromising the style of the property. These options can be designed to look similar to the original windows and will keep the house warm while retaining its historic style.
